What is Cosmetology

Wetmore KS makeup school studentCosmetology is an occupation that is all about making the human body look more beautiful through the use of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are referred to as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ic may be almost anything that enhances the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states require that you undergo some form of specialized training and then be licensed. Once licensed, the work settings include not only Wetmore KS beauty salons and barber shops, but also such venues as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have gotten experience and a clientele, open their own shops or salons. Others will begin seeing customers either in their own residences or will travel to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ates have many professional names and work in a wide range of specializations including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As already mentioned, in the majority of states practicing cosmetologists must be licensed. In some states there is an exemption. Only those offering more skilled services, for instance h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to get lic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ees

Wetmore KS hair design student cutting hairThere are essentially two avenues available to obtain c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s usually take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in each of the main are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are offered if you wish to focus on just one area, such as hair coloring. A degree program will also likely feature management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to manage a parlor or other Wetmore KS business. Higher deg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such areas as salon or spa management. Whatever type of training program you choose, it’s important to make certain that it’s recognized by the Kansas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ain respected agencies,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Cosmetologist Classes

Wetmore KS student attending online beauty schoolOnline cosmetology schools are accommodating for Wetmore KS students who are working full-time and have family responsibilities that make it hard to enroll in a more traditional school. There are numerous web-based beauty school programs available that can be attended by means of a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ional beauty schools are typically fast paced since many programs are as brief as 6 or 8 months. This means that a considerable portion of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are dealing with the same amount of material, but you are not devoting numerous hours outside of your home or driving back and forth from classes. However, it’s essential that the training program you choose can provide internship training in nearby salons and parlors to ensure that you also obtain the hands-on training needed for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s difficult to gain the skills needed to work in any facet of the cosmetology profession. So be sure if you choose to enroll in an online school to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s important to make sure that the cosmetology school you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ards assu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be essential for obtaining student loans or financial aid, which typically are not obtainable in 66550 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, a number of Wetmore KS employers will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on those with accredited training.

Does the School have a Good Reputation?  Each beauty college that you are seriously considering should have a good to outstanding reputation within the industry. Being accredited is a good starting point. Next, ask the schools for endorsements from their network of employers where they have placed their students. Verify that the schools have high job placement rates, indicating that their students are highly sought after. Check rating companies for reviews along with the school’s accrediting organizations. If you have any contacts with Wetmore KS salon owners or managers, or someone working in the business, ask them if they are familiar with the schools you are reviewing. They might even be able to suggest others that you had not considered. And finally, consult the Kansas school licensing authority to see if there have been any grievances submitted or if the schools are in total compliance.

What’s the School’s Specialty?  Some cosmetology schools offer programs that are comprehensive in nature, focusing on all areas of cosmetology. Others are more focused, offering training in a specific specialty, such as h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s typically bro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s important that you pick a school that focuses on your area of interest. If your ambition is to be trained as an esthetician, make sure that the school you enroll in is accredited and respected for that program. If your dream is to open a hair salon in Wetmore KS, then you want to enroll in a degree program that will instruct you how to be an owner/operator. Picking a highly ranked school with a poor program in the specialty you are pursuing will not provide the training you need.

Is Any Hands-On Training Provided?  Studying and mastering cosmetology techniques and abilities involves plenty of practice on people. Ask how much live, hands-on training is provided in the beauty classes you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on campus that enable students to practice their developing talents on volunteers. If a beauty program furnishes minimal or no scheduled live training, but rather relies heavily on using mannequins, it might not be the best option for acquiring your skills. So search for alternate schools that offer this kind of training.

Does the School have a Job Placement Program?  When a student graduates from a cosmetology school, it’s imperative that she or he gets help in finding that initial job. Job placement programs are an important part of that process. Schools that furnish help develope relationships with Wetmore KS businesses that are seeking qualified graduates available for hiring. Check that the programs you are contemplating have job placement programs and ask which salons and organizations they refer students to. Additionally, ask what their job placement rates are. Higher rates not only affirm that they have broad networks of employers, but that their programs are highly regarded as well.

Is Financial Assistance Available?  Almost all cosmetology schools offer financ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Check if the schools you are considering have a financial aid office. Consult with a counselor and learn what student loans or grants you may qualify for. If the school is a member of the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ships offered to students also. If a school fulfills each of your other qualifications with the exception of cost, do not drop it as an option until you learn what financial aid may be available.

    Wetmore, Kansas

    Wetmore is located at 39°38′4″N 95°48′34″W / 39.63444°N 95.80944°W / 39.63444; -95.80944 (39.634522, -95.809462).[10] According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 0.39 square miles (1.01 km2), all of it land.[1]

    As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 368 people, 140 households, and 89 families residing in the city. The population density was 943.6 inhabitants per square mile (364.3/km2). There were 152 housing units at an average density of 389.7 per square mile (150.5/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 96.7% White, 0.3% African American, 1.9% Native American, and 1.1%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 1.9% of the population.

    There were 140 households of which 37.9%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 47.1% were married couples living together, 10.0% had a female householder with no husband present, 6.4% had a male householder with no wife present, and 36.4% were non-families. 30.7% of all households were made up of individuals and 14.3%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.63 and the average family size was 3.26.
